NY stretch limo fatal crash - officials seized airbag module - why?
Some guy on the evening news claimed it was the vehicle's "black box recorder"
eh? Some of the airbag controllers I have seen are quite simple and independent. They would not be logging data. I would think the ECU is more likely to do this. I believe they store maxima for the last engine start: things like speed, RPM, temperature. |

I believe they store >maxima for the last engine start: things like speed, RPM, temperature. They might, but the airbag controllers have accelerometers in them. If the accelerometer data has been logged, it could be very interesting for crash analysis. --scott -- "C'est un Nagra. C'est suisse, et tres, tres precis." |
